Educational Technologist Salary in South Carolina

How much does an Educational Technologist make in South Carolina? The average Educational Technologist salary in South Carolina is $60,279 as of February 27, 2023, but the range typically falls between $51,774 and $70,040.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on the city and many other important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. Job Description

Supports faculty members utilizing information technology in support of teaching and learning. Develops computer training materials and assists in teaching how to set up and use computer applications and related technologies. May troubleshoot technical problems and train junior staff members. Typically requ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a manager. Gains ex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. Occ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. Typically requires 2 to 4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2023 Salary.com)
